antigrowth
/ˌæntiˈɡroʊθ, ˌænˈtɪɡroʊθ/Definitions
1. noun
opposition to economic growth or a policy aimed at reducing or preventing it
“The government’s antigrowth policies have led to widespread criticism from the business community.”
2. adjective
relating to or characterized by opposition to economic growth or a policy aimed at reducing or preventing it
“The antigrowth coalition is made up of environmental groups and local communities.”
